This Global Certificate Course in Fishery Stock Assessment Surveys provides comprehensive training in modern techniques for evaluating fish populations. Participants gain practical skills in data collection, analysis, and interpretation, crucial for sustainable fisheries management.
Learning outcomes include mastering software for stock assessment, understanding different survey methodologies (acoustic surveys, trawl surveys, etc.), and developing proficiency in statistical modeling for population dynamics. The program covers both theoretical frameworks and hands-on applications.
The course duration is typically six weeks, delivered through a blended learning approach combining online modules with practical workshops and potentially field trips, depending on the specific program offered. This flexible format caters to professionals with busy schedules.
